July is the month where not much happens.

Ava and Lilly spend July like most of their summers, together, playing inside or outside, and talking and laughing for hours until the early hours of the morning.

Though, it's different than any other summer, different for obvious reasons.

They're a couple now, girlfriends, who lay close together in bed talking and laughing all night long, with their hands pressed together or hugging each other fully.
There's never much space between them when they're alone now, especially at night, when Ava's mom and siblings are asleep.

Speaking of her siblings, Ava and Lilly do agree to take Anne and Andy to the local park on some days during the work week.

And Donna thanks them for it by keeping the kids out of Ava's room when Lilly sleeps over.

July also has a few more mini road trips sprinkled in with Lucas and Rose, which leave them all tired and joyful.

There are a few moments of growth in July, moments of working towards mending wounds on Louise's part and openness on Lilly's part.

Moments such as Louise finding a pink, white, and orange t-shirt at the store randomly and giving it to Lilly, remembering it being the colors of her flag and saying how it's pretty.

Moments such as Lilly answering questions about how herself and Ava got together, laughing at her self from a few months ago, being so overrun with emotions that she just kissed Ava.

For something so bold, Louise doesn't judge her at all. She laughs along with her daughter.

July goes by quick, but Ava and Lilly make the best of it, continuing on to get to August.
